Radon is the second leading cause of lung cancer in the U.S., responsible for approximately 21,000 deaths each year. The gas is invisible, odorless and tasteless, so testing is the only way to detect it.

Radon is a naturally occurring radioactive gas released when uranium in the soil decays. It can enter buildings through cracks and other openings in the foundation before accumulating indoors.
Radon exposure is the leading cause of lung cancer among nonsmokers, and the gas is classified as a Class A carcinogen.
Any home is at risk for elevated radon levels. Because radon can’t be seen, tasted or smelled, the only way to understand your home’s levels is through testing.
Soil composition and foundation types influence how radon enters properties. Even neighboring homes can have different levels.
